It's time for Eurovision fans to rejoice and everyone else to look away and find something else to talk about - for the names of the next batch of Latvian "Supernova" hopefuls have been released into the public sphere.

16 acts have survived the initial cull perpetrated by the jury, who were originally presented with 33 acts to assess and, if deemed necessary, send packing.

Those who survived will now battle it out in two semi finals and a final to decide who will be the Latvian representative at the 64th Eurovision song contest to take place next year in Tel Aviv, Israel. They are:

  • Samanta Tīna
  • Markus Riva
  • Elza Rozentāle
  • Edgars Kreilis
  • Adriana Miglāne
  • “Double Faced Eels”
  • “Dziļi Violets feat. Kozmens”
  • “Laime Pilnīga”
  • “Laika Upe”
  • “Carousel”
  • “Kris & Oz”
  • Kristiāna Bumbiere
  • Alekss Silvērs
  • Aivo Oskis
  • Kristīne Pastare (Peress)
  • Līga Rīdere

The selection of artistes features several incredibly familiar faces such as Samanta Tina and Markus Riva, whose dedication to pursuing a Eurovision ticket knows no bounds and who have once again placed themselves in the line of fire as they seek Eurovision glory.

The exact dates of the Supernova shows are yet to be confirmed, but will take place in the first quarter of 2019, with the international competition taking place May 14-18 in Israel.
